What are Money-Saving Apps?

Money-saving apps are digital tools designed to help individuals manage their finances and reduce unnecessary expenses. These applications come in various formats, each with unique features aimed at making saving money easier and more efficient.

Many people wonder how these apps work. They often connect to your bank accounts and track your spending habits. By analyzing your finances, they provide insights and suggestions on how to cut costs and save more. Are you looking to boost your savings? Let’s explore the types and benefits of these apps!

Types of Money-Saving Apps

There are several categories of money-saving apps to consider, each serving a specific need.

  • Budgeting Apps: These allow you to create budgets and track your expenses in real-time.
  • Coupon and Cashback Apps: These apps help you find discounts and earn money back on purchases.
  • Investment Apps: They facilitate investing small amounts of money, helping your savings grow over time.
  • Bill Management Apps: These can remind you of bill payments and track due dates to prevent late fees.

Each type serves a purpose, whether it’s to keep track of spending or to find the best deals. Many users have found that using multiple apps in combination can greatly enhance their financial well-being.

Top 5 Money-Saving Apps to Try

In today’s world, using money-saving apps can significantly enhance your financial management. With so many options available, it can be overwhelming to choose which apps to try. Here are the top five recommendations that can help you save money effectively and easily.

1. Mint

Mint is a popular app that consolidates your bank accounts, credit cards, and bills in one place. It tracks your spending, creates budgets, and provides insights on your financial habits. Many users appreciate its user-friendly interface and clear visuals.

2. PocketGuard

PocketGuard simplifies budgeting by showing you how much money is left to spend after bills and savings. This app helps users avoid overspending, making it easier to stick to a budget. It’s great for individuals who want to quickly understand their financial flows.

3. Ibotta

Ibotta offers cashback deals on everyday purchases. After shopping, users simply upload their receipts to redeem cashback. This app is beneficial for those who love saving money on groceries, dining out, and more.

4. YNAB (You Need A Budget)

YNAB is designed to help users gain complete control over their finances. Its focus on proactive budgeting enables users to plan for future expenses effectively. Additionally, YNAB provides excellent educational resources to empower your budgeting skills.

5. Honey

Honey is a browser extension that finds and applies coupon codes automatically at checkout. Users save time and money on online shopping without the hassle of searching for promotions. With its simplicity, Honey has become a favorite for savvy shoppers.

Using these money-saving apps can streamline your financial management and lead to significant savings over time. Each app offers unique features to cater to different financial needs, making it easier for you to find the perfect fit.

How to Choose the Right App for You

Choosing the right money-saving app can feel overwhelming given the many options available. The perfect app should align with your financial goals and habits. Below are some tips to help you make an informed choice.

1. Identify Your Financial Goals

Understanding your specific needs is critical. Are you looking to budget better, track spending, or find discounts? Are you trying to save for a trip or pay off debt? By identifying your goals, you can narrow down the options that best fit your situation.

2. Consider User Experience

An app’s ease of use can greatly affect its effectiveness. Look for apps that have simple, user-friendly interfaces. Read reviews and check ratings to find out what other users think about their experiences. You want an app that makes finance management straightforward.

3. Look for Essential Features

Different apps come with various features. Consider the tools that matter most to you. For example, some apps offer budgeting tools, while others provide cashback offers or investment options. Make a list of must-have features and compare apps accordingly.

  • Budgeting Tools: Does the app help you create and maintain a budget?
  • Spending Insights: Can it track your spending patterns effectively?
  • Rewards Programs: Does the app offer cashback or rewards for your purchases?
  • Customer Support: Is there support available if you run into issues?

Being aware of the features you value will help you find an app that enhances your financial management. Additionally, some apps may offer free trials, allowing you to test their features before committing.

4. Evaluate Security Measures

Security is essential when it comes to handling financial information. Before choosing an app, check what level of encryption and data protection it offers. Look for apps that prioritize user privacy and have good security reviews.

After evaluating these points, you should feel more confident in selecting a money-saving app that works for you. Finding the right app can make managing your finances much easier and help you achieve your savings goals.

Common Mistakes to Avoid with Money-Saving Apps

When using money-saving apps, it’s important to avoid common pitfalls that could hinder your savings efforts. Recognizing and steering clear of these mistakes can help you maximize your experience with these financial tools.

1. Not Setting a Budget

A common mistake is failing to create a budget. Without a clear plan, you may not understand where your money is going. Set a realistic budget using your chosen app to track income and expenses effectively. This will provide you with insights into your spending habits.

2. Ignoring Alerts and Notifications

Many money-saving apps offer alerts and notifications to help you stay on track with your finances. Ignoring these reminders can lead to overspending or missed savings opportunities. Enable notifications to get reminders about bills, budget limits, and special deals.

3. Not Regularly Reviewing Your Finances

Another mistake is not reviewing your financial data regularly. It’s easy to download an app and think you’re done. However, making time to check your spending and tweak your budget frequently ensures you’re making the most of the app.

  • Weekly Check-Ins: Spend a few minutes each week reviewing your spending and budget.
  • Adjustments: Be ready to adjust your budget based on your findings.
  • Look for Trends: Identify spending patterns that may need to change.

Keeping an eye on your account can lead to better decision-making and encourage you to save more.

4. Overlooking Hidden Fees

Many apps have hidden fees that can eat into your savings. Always read the fine print when you download an app. Some may charge for premium features that you might not need. Be sure to understand any costs associated with using the app to avoid unexpected charges.

5. Relying Solely on the App

While money-saving apps can be invaluable, relying solely on them for financial management can be a mistake. It’s important to combine the app’s insights with your financial knowledge and discipline. Stay engaged with your financial goals and use the app as a tool, not a crutch.

By avoiding these common mistakes, you can enhance your experience with money-saving apps and ultimately improve your financial health. Remember, success in saving comes from a combination of using the right tools and being proactive about your finances.
